Chief Minister announces crackdown on financial crime

Chief Minister Howard Quayle says the government will publish a new strategy to help tackle financial crime and money laundering soon.

In the House of Keys yesterday he faced questions from Ramsey MHK Lawrie Hooper about a recent assessment of the Island carried out by MONEYVAL.

The European organisation, which combats terrorism financing and money laundering, found a number of weaknesses in the Island's regulatory systems.

Mr Quayle says it's something he takes seriously:
